Flying from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L) to Perth Airport (PER): what you need to know
Around 7 hours 10 minutes is how long you'll be traveling on a direct flight from Ninoy Aquino International Airport to Perth Airport.
Manila and Perth follow the same timezone, UTC+8.
Flights from MNL to PER start from 00:05 — the earliest with Philippine Airlines. The last departure is at 05:30 with Philippine Airlines. Overall, you can take your pick of three weekly Ninoy Aquino International Airport to Perth Airport flights.

Getting from Perth Airport (PER) to central Perth
Perth Airport to the center of Perth has a drive time of about 20 minutes. It's approximately 16 kilometers away.
When traveling on public transport, expect a journey of about 30 minutes.
When to fly to Perth Airport (PER)
July is the busiest month for flights from Ninoy Aquino International Airport to Perth Airport. To avoid the crowds, travel to Perth in February.
When booking your flight from Ninoy Aquino International Airport to Perth Airport, think about the kind of weather you enjoy. January is the warmest month in Perth, with the temperature ranging from 17ºC (63ºF) to 35ºC (95ºF).
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from MNL to PER in August. Temperatures average between 8ºC (46ºF) and 20ºC (68ºF) then.
